Gallery resizing.

Is there a way to make a gallery in the Ribbon resize as the office ribbon does. Specifically, I'd like the Gallery to consume as much space as it can up to a maximum number of items displayed (say 8), then shrink smoothly to a minimum size of 3 items shown before being collapsed.

To put it another way, I would like the shrink process to be:

  1. Display all 8 items in gallery preview.
  2. Display 7 items.
  3. Display 6 items.
  4. Display 5 items.
  5. Display 4 items.
  6. Display 3 items.
  7. Collapse to a gallery button.

Am I missing something obvious here?